About Satellite
|
||||||
|
---------------
|
||||||
|
Satellite is CORBA support for PHP using ORBit.
|
||||||
|
|
||||||
|
The original version was made by David Eriksson <eriksson@php.net>
|
||||||
|
during the summer 2000.
|
||||||
|
|
||||||
|
|
||||||
|
Installation
|
||||||
|
------------
|
||||||
|
Read below about installing ORBit.
|
||||||
|
|
||||||
|
Then create a directory on your server for your IDL files, and add
|
||||||
|
an entry to your php.ini like this:
|
||||||
|
|
||||||
|
idl_directory = /var/idl
|
||||||
|
|
||||||
|
Note: If you compile Satellite as a dynamic PHP extension you must have the
|
||||||
|
above line located before the extension=satellite.so line in php.ini!
|
||||||
|
|
||||||
|
PHP as an Apache static module
|
||||||
|
------------------------------
|
||||||
|
Before linking Apache you must do either of these things:
|
||||||
|
|
||||||
|
a) Before running Apache's configure you set the environment variable
|
||||||
|
LIBS like this:
|
||||||
|
|
||||||
|
export LIBS="`orbit-config --libs client` `libIDL-config --libs`"
|
||||||
|
|
||||||
|
b) You edit apache/src/modules/php4/libphp4.module and
|
||||||
|
add `orbit-config --libs client` `libIDL-config --libs`
|
||||||
|
within the quotes on the line beginning with LIBS=
|
||||||
|
|
||||||
|
|
||||||
|
What version of ORBit is required?
|
||||||
|
----------------------------------
|
||||||
|
You need the CVS version of ORBit to use Satellite!
|
||||||
|
|
||||||
|
This does NOT work with ORBit 0.5.3 or earlier.
|
||||||
|
|
||||||
|
|
||||||
|
How to install ORBit from CVS
|
||||||
|
-----------------------------
|
||||||
|
|
||||||
|
(1) Get it from CVS
|
||||||
|
|
||||||
|
CVS root: :pserver:anonymous@anoncvs.gnome.org:/cvs/gnome
|
||||||
|
Password: Empty string
|
||||||
|
Directory: ORBit
|
||||||
|
|
||||||
|
More about GNOME:s CVS on http://www.gnome.org/start/source.html
|
||||||
|
|
||||||
|
(2) Set the environment variable CERTIFIED_GNOMIE to whatever you like.
|
||||||
|
|
||||||
|
(3) Run ./autogen.sh, gmake och gmake install
